Thursday Night Football: Chargers Overwhelm Chiefs, 31-13

Philip Rivers threw two touchdown passes and the Chargers’ defense added two late scores on Chiefs’ turnovers, as San Diego routed visiting Kansas City, 31-13, on Thursday night.

Leading 10-6 after three quarters, San Diego (4-4) scored three touchdowns in the final period, including Shaun Phillips’ recovery of a fumble by Kansas City quarterback Matt Cassel and Demorrio Williams’ 59-yard interception return. Cassel now has 18 turnovers on the year.

Kansas City (1-7) managed just two Ryan Succop field goals and a meaningless late touchdown on a 6-yard run by Shaun Draughn with 4:26 to play. Dwayne Bowe led the Chiefs with eight catches for 79 yards. He also fumbled in Chargers’ territory on Kansas City’s first drive of the game. The Chiefs committed four turnovers on Thursday, raising their league-leading total to 29.

Rivers completed 18 of 20 pass attempts for 220 yards, including touchdown tosses to Antonio Gates and Malcom Floyd.
